Anthony Hernandez vs. Michel Pereira UFC Odds, Time, and Prediction
Anthony Hernandez vs. Michel Pereira is the main event of UFC Fight Night 245, which is taking place at UFC Apex on Saturday, October 19, 2024.

Anthony Hernandez (12-2-1) is undefeated in his last five fights, and if he wins again, he’ll probably move much higher in the UFC Middleweight Rankings than his current position (No. 13). Winning the UFC Fight Night 245 main event won’t be easy as he’s fighting against Michel Pereira (31-11-2) who’s 8-0 in his last eight fights. He’s 14th in the rankings, but another win would almost certainly get him to the Top 10.

Anthony Hernandez Has Turned into a TD Master
Anthony Hernandez is a well-rounded fighter with 10 finishes in his portfolio. Eight of those happened by submission, which shows how dangerous he is when the fight goes to the ground. Most of his fights did get there as he’s very good when it comes to takedowns.
In fact, this has become his style over the last couple of years. His TD average is 6.62, while in his last four UFC fights, he landed 25 TDs.

What’s interesting is that even though submission is his favorite method, this guy also tends to land a lot of strikes. In each of his last five fights – all of which he won – he landed more significant strikes than his opponent.
The best thing is that he’s fought against some really good strikers, including Marc-Andre Barriault, Roman Kopylov, and Edmen Shahbazyan.
Michel Pereira Wants to Take His Career to the Next Level
Michel Pereira is still relatively young for an MMA fighter. He’s 31, but he’s already fought 44 professional fights. He wasn’t too successful in the early days of his career, but he now seems to be in his prime.
“Demolidor” won each of his last eight fights, and his run would’ve been even longer if it hadn’t been for the DQ loss against Diego Sanchez in early 2020. He was winning that fight but was disqualified in Round 3 for an illegal knee.
What’s interesting is that his last two wins happened by submission. What’s even more interesting is that both of those happened with both fighters on their feet. In fact, this guy has made zero takedowns in his last three fights.
He prefers to fight standing up, and there’s a very good reason for that. Not only is he an expert in guillotine and rear naked chokes, but he’s also a fantastic boxer. He lands more than 5 significant strikes a minute.
He’s got 11 wins by KO/TKO, 9 by submission, and 11 by decision, which shows that he’s got plenty of weapons in his arsenal.
